Official Streaming Services for Dodgers Games
Alright, let's start with the big leagues – the official streaming services. These are usually your most reliable options, providing high-quality streams and all the bells and whistles. Official streaming services typically offer the most comprehensive coverage, including pre-game shows, post-game analysis, and sometimes even exclusive content. The Dodgers, being a major league team, are pretty well covered, so you have options.
One of the primary places to look is MLB.TV. This is the official streaming service of Major League Baseball. MLB.TV is fantastic, especially if you're a die-hard baseball fan. It gives you access to almost every out-of-market game. The downside? Blackout restrictions. If the Dodgers are playing in your local market, you might be blacked out. This is where things can get a little tricky, but don't worry, we'll cover the workarounds later. MLB.TV offers different subscription tiers, so you can choose the one that best fits your needs. You can catch the Dodgers with the MLB app on your phone, tablet, smart tv, or computer. MLB.TV often has a pretty good user interface, making it easy to navigate and find the game you want to watch. They also have a lot of bonus features like archived games and on-demand content, allowing you to catch up on any game you might have missed. For many, MLB.TV is the go-to choice for streaming baseball.

Troubleshooting Streaming Issues
Even with the best streaming services, you might run into a few snags. Don't worry, here's some quick troubleshooting tips.
Buffering: If your stream is constantly buffering, it's usually a problem with your internet connection. Make sure you have a fast and stable internet connection. Close other apps or devices that are using bandwidth. Consider upgrading your internet plan if you are consistently having issues.
Picture Quality: If the picture quality is poor, check your streaming settings. Most streaming services let you adjust the video quality. Make sure you're set to the highest quality your internet connection can handle. Sometimes, restarting your device or the streaming app can help.
Blackout Restrictions: Double-check the blackout rules for your area. If you're getting a blackout message, you may not be able to watch the game on that particular service. You might need to use a different service or consider a VPN (Virtual Private Network) to bypass restrictions. Use a VPN at your own risk.
Audio Issues: Make sure your volume is turned up on your device and your TV. Check that your audio settings are correctly configured for your device. Restarting the app can often fix audio problems.
